Novel Ru III ‐DMSO Complexes of the Antiherpes Drug Acyclovir

Treatment of the anionic Ru III precursor X[ trans ‐RuCl 4 (DMSO‐ S ) 2 ] (X = protonated DMSO, Na + , NH 4 + ) and acyclovir (acv) in various solvents yields two new products mer ‐[RuCl 3 (acv)(DMSO‐ S )(CH 3 OH)]·0.5CH 3 OH ( 1 ) and mer ‐[RuCl 3 (acv)(DMSO‐ S )(H 2 O)]·H 2 O ( 2 ) in which hydrogen bonds between the acv purine oxygen and coordinated methanol or water, respectively, play an important role.
